U15 Girls Cricket Team

Posted: June 24th, 2015

The Under 15 girls cricket team took part in a 8 a side Chance to Compete competition held at Little Stoke. They have been training every Monday night with a coach from Audley Cricket Club. They won 2 out of 3 games and so qualified for the semi-finals of the County competition, held at Penkridge Cricket Club last week.

The girls played well, but found runs hard to find and finished on a total of 39 in the limited overs game. Thomas Alleynes of Uttoxeter managed to hit 40 with one over remaining and so went through to the County finals.
